Before a walk begins, managers should pick a theme to guide the entire Gemba walk. This narrows the focus of the Gemba walk and yields better results, as attention is not spread amongst different themes and objectives. Gemba means “actual place” in Japanese. Lean Thinkers use it to mean the place where value is created.
